2026 Cultural and Creative Product Design Competition
Competition Theme: World Dulcimer Art · Creative Legacy

Event Highlights:
🌟 Publication Opportunity: The top 5 works will be included in the association's "Official Cultural & Creative Products" website, for global distribution.
🌟 Product Realization: Winning designs will be manufactured into physical products by the association and sold at the next event for charity, with proceeds used to promote dulcimer art.
🌟 Honorary Recognition: Designers will receive an award certificate from the association and retain the right of authorship for their work. The right to use the work will be owned by the association, and the final product will be given to the designer for collection.
Eligibility:
This competition is open globally to dulcimer enthusiasts of all ages, students, teachers and students from art institutions, and creative professionals.
Submission Requirements:
- Works must feature the "dulcimer" as the core design element, embodying its cultural essence or artistic beauty.
- Submissions can be hand-drawn or computer-designed. Please submit design drafts and a creative explanation (under 300 words).
- No style limitations.
- Design drafts must be clear. Hand-drawn drafts should be scanned into JPG or PDF format (resolution no less than 300dpi); computer-drawn designs should be submitted as original files or high-resolution JPG/PNG.
- Each submission must include a brief design concept explanation (under 300 words).
Submission Deadline:
June 30, 2026, 23:59 (based on email sending time; late submissions will not be accepted).
How to Submit:
Please send the electronic version of your work (minimum 3MB) to the official email: info@interdulcimer.com. The email subject should be "World Dulcimer Cultural & Creative Competition + Name + Contact Information".

Selection Process:
- Preliminary Review: Association staff will verify eligibility and completeness of submissions.
- Secondary Review: The expert committee of the International Dulcimer Art Association will conduct a professional review.
- Result Announcement: The judging panel will select the "Top 5" shortlisted works. Results will be announced on the association's official channels two weeks after the deadline, and selected participants will be notified via email.
Awards and Subsequent Rights:
1. The "Top 5" shortlisted works will be collected and officially published by the association (forms include, but are not limited to, association publications, cultural & creative products, or digital publications).
2. The association will be responsible for manufacturing the "Top 5" designs into physical products. These products will be sold at the association's next major event for charity (charity sale), with proceeds used to promote dulcimer art and public welfare.
3. As the highest tribute to the designers, the association will present the manufactured final product to the designer for permanent collection after the event.
Intellectual Property and Copyright Statement:
Submitted works must be original. Plagiarism and unauthorized use of others' works are strictly prohibited. In case of copyright disputes, participants shall bear legal responsibility, and the association reserves the right to disqualify them and reclaim awards.
Copyright Authorization:
1. For the "Top 5" shortlisted works, the rights of production, sale, and publication belong to the International Dulcimer Art Association. The association has the right to convert them into products.
2. Participants retain the right of authorship for their works.
3. Copyright for unshortlisted works belongs to the authors, but the association has the right to display relevant works for promotion of this competition.
